Parkland (TSE:PKI) PT Lowered to C$49.00

Parkland (TSE:PKIFree Report) had its price target decreased by Royal Bank of Canada from C$50.00 to C$49.00 in a research report report published on Wednesday morning, BayStreet.CA reports.

PKI has been the topic of several other research reports. CIBC cut their target price on Parkland from C$55.00 to C$54.00 in a research note on Thursday, July 18th. BMO Capital Markets cut their price target on shares of Parkland from C$55.00 to C$52.00 in a research report on Tuesday, July 16th. National Bankshares decreased their price objective on shares of Parkland from C$52.00 to C$49.00 and set an outperform rating for the company in a report on Tuesday. Desjardins cut their target price on shares of Parkland from C$51.00 to C$48.00 and set a buy rating on the stock in a report on Tuesday. Finally, JPMorgan Chase & Co. reduced their price target on shares of Parkland from C$56.00 to C$54.00 in a research report on Tuesday, April 16th. Two investment anal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and ten have issued a buy rating to the company’s st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, Parkland has an average rating of Moderate Buy and an average price target of C$50.69.

Parkland Trading Up 2.0 %

PKI opened at C$38.57 on Wednesday. Parkland has a fifty-two week low of C$35.00 and a fifty-two week high of C$47.99. The company has a market cap of C$6.74 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 17.77,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 11.79 and a beta of 1.37.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 210.21, a current ratio of 1.37 and a quick ratio of 0.73. The firm has a 50 day simple moving average of C$38.36 and a 200 day simple moving average of C$41.84.

Parkland (TSE:PKIG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Wednesday, May 1st. The company reported C$0.25 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of C$0.06 by C$0.19. The company had revenue of C$6.94 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of C$8.13 billion. Parkland had a net margin of 1.25% and a return on equity of 12.52%. On average, sell-side analysts anticipate that Parkland will post 3.1594793 earnings per share for the current year.

Parkland Dividend Announcement

The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Monday, July 15th. Investors of record on Friday, June 21st were paid a $0.35 dividend. This represents a $1.40 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 3.63%. The ex-dividend date was Thursday, June 20th. Parkland’s payout ratio is presently 64.52%.

About Parkland

Parkland Corporation operates food and convenience stores in Canada, the United States, and internationally. The company's Canada segment owns, supplies, and supports a coast-to-coast network of retail gas stations, electronic vehicle charging stations, frozen food retail locations, convenience stores, cardlock sites, bulk fuel, propane, heating oil, lubricants, and other related services to commercial, industrial, and residential customers; transports and distributes fuel through ships, rail, and highway carriers; and stores fuel in terminals and other owned and leased facilities, as well as engages in the low-carbon activities.
